Overview

Dr. Kemmerer is a board-certified cancer physician whose clinical interests include cancer of the lung, breast and prostate. He attended Temple University School of Medicine, where he earned his medical degree. He completed residencies at Wayne State University and Drexel University College of Medicine. Dr. Kemmerer is certified by the American Board of Radiology in radiation oncology.

Dr. Kemmerer is rated as an Experienced provider by MediFind in the treatment of Breast Cancer in Men. His top areas of expertise are ALK-Positive Non-Small Cell Lung Cancer, Lung Adenocarcinoma, Squamous Cell Lung Carcinoma, and Small Cell Lung Cancer (SCLC).

His clinical research consists of co-authoring 5 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years.
